The Brecon 100 bike ride starts in Caerleon on the outskirts of Newport where the ancient Romans once settled. In your bid to become a cycling Centurian the ride takes a picturesque route towards the Brecon Beacons National Park to conquer the challenging but stunning wilderness that is typical of the area, along with some wicked climbs. You’ll have to overcome a landscape that is open and exposed to the elements to complete this ride whether you choose the 100km or 100-mile route.
